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| bearded pig | ミナミツミ |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(動物) | Animalia (動物)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(脊索動物) | Chordata (脊索動物) |
| Class | Mammalia (哺乳類) | Aves (鳥類) |
| Order | Artiodactyla (偶蹄目) | Accipitriformes (タカ目) |
| Family | Suidae (Pigs) | Accipitridae (Hawks & Eagles) |
| Genus | Sus (Pigs) | Accipiter |
| Species | Sus barbatus | Accipiter virgatus |
